โฆ Synopsis
We performed the precision measurements of the near-normal far-infrared reflection and transmission spectra of the MBE-grown (GaAs) n /(AlAs) n (n = 1, 2, 4) superlattices. The results obtained show a noticeable (almost twofold) increase in the AlAs-phonon damping when n is decreased from 4 to 1. We consider possible physical mechanisms of this increase and compare our results with those obtained by other authors. The main implication of the work is that the increase in the TO-phonon damping may be related to interface broadening whose role becomes more important when the superlattice period decreases.
